Description of Excel Add-in Development in C/C++
Excel is the industry standard for financial modelling, providing a number of ways for users to extend the functionality of their own add-ins, including VB. C/C++. Excel Add-in Developments in C/C++ - Applications for Finance is a how-to guide and reference book for the creation of high performance add-ins for Excel in C and C++ for users in the finance industry.

Author Steve Dalton explains how to apply Excel add-ins to financial applications with many examples given throughout the book. It also covers the relative strengths and weaknesses of developing add-ins for Excel in VB versus C/C++, and provides several thousand lines of code, workbooks and example projects on the accompanying CD-ROM.

- Features extensive example codes in VB, C and C++, explaining all the ways in which a developer can achieve their objectives.

- Contains a number of example projects that demonstrate, from start to finish, the potential of Excel when powerful add-ins can be easily developed.

- Developes the readers understanding of the relative strengths and weaknesses of developing add-ins for Excel in VB versus C/C++.

- Includes CD-ROM with several thousand lines of example code and numerous workbooks, and a number of complete example projects.

Authobiography of Steve Dalton
STEVE DALTON is currently head of Exotic Options at Collins Stewart Tullett plc in London. Steve has almost 20 years of experience working in the fields of interest rate derivatives and IT.

With a background in mathematics and computing, he pioneered the use of real-time spreadsheets in the mid 1980s for arbitrage and derivatives pricing. He founded Eigensys Ltd in the late 1980s, which specialises in software and consultancy in this field and in the use of Excel for demanding real-time applications.
